%20in%20formatierten%20Bib-Eintr%C3%A4gen.png)
Für jede Hilfe zu Folgendem wäre ich dankbar. Natbib, Agsm geben mir derzeit:
Braun, V. und Clarke, V. (2006), „Verwendung thematischer Analysen in der Psychologie“, Qualitative Research in Psychology, 3(2), S. 77–101.
Was ich wirklich will, ist:
Braun, V. und Clarke, V. (2006) „Verwendung thematischer Analysen in der Psychologie“, Qualitative Research in Psychology, 3(2), S. 77–101.
D. h.: Wie entfernen wir das Komma nach (Jahr)?
Danke,
Asche
Antwort1
Dies scheint zu funktionieren:
\begin{filecontents*}{\jobname.bib}
@article{braun-clarke2006,
author={Braun, V. and Clarke, V.},
year={2006},
title={Using thematic analysis in psychology},
journal={Qualitative Research in Psychology},
volume={3},
number={2},
pages={77–101},
}
\end{filecontents*}
\documentclass{article}
\usepackage{natbib}
\AtBeginDocument{\renewcommand{\harvardand}{and}} % no &, please!
\renewcommand{\harvardyearright}{)\gobblecomma}
\makeatletter
\newcommand{\gobblecomma}{\@ifnextchar,{\@gobble}{}}
\makeatother
\begin{document}
\cite{braun-clarke2006}
\bibliographystyle{agsm}
\bibliography{\jobname}
\end{document}
Erläuterung. Der Eintrag in der .bbl
Datei ist
\harvarditem{Braun \harvardand\ Clarke}{2006}{braun-clarke2006}
Braun, V. \harvardand\ Clarke, V. \harvardyearleft 2006\harvardyearright ,
`Using thematic analysis in psychology', {\em Qualitative Research in
Psychology} {\bf 3}(2),~77–101.
es geht also darum, es neu zu definieren, \harvardyearright
um die Klammern zu erzeugen, und auch einen Befehl, der das nächste Zeichen verschlingt, wenn es ein Komma ist. Ich habe auch das schreckliche „&“ in „und“ geändert.